Though no electronic act bested <a href="spotify:artist:5HAtRoEPUvGSA7ziTGB1cF">the Orb</a> at creating a satisfying fusion of ambient music and dub, Sub Dub came the closest with its blend of studio production and live instrumentation. The quartet, which includes bassist John Ward, programmer <a href="spotify:artist:4iY5ZMs1Li6MvY24CBfb9Y">Raz Mesinai</a>, vocalist Ursula Ward, and <a href="spotify:artist:6IZ7GpoXDwKj3t7zaYCzOL">Grant Stewart</a> on tenor sax, debuted in 1994 with the Babylon Unite EP on TKI. After one more EP, Dawa Zangpo, Sub Dub released their debut album in 1996 on Instinct. Dancehall Malfunction followed in 1997. ~ John Bush, Rovi
